    May 14, 2012 - Popped and poured. Light translucent reddish-burgundy in color. Palate of earthyness, forest mushrooms and red fruit. No creosote or road tar flavors common to Barolo. This is from the VERY hot 2003 vintage and my guess is that the grapes are riper than average. The acidity seems a bit lower than customary in a Barolo and the tanins are no where near fierce. There is an apparent fruity sweetness on the back of the palate, which may represent the tanins doing what they are supposed to do as they breat up. The wine is very approachable now for a Barolo that is just past 8 years old. I do not know how this will age and I believe it has yet to reach its peak, but it is quite pleasant right now.
